Barry first found music when he borrowed his sister's record collection when he was about eight and was hooked. When Caroline started it was a new beginning, and he listened to all the stations, but Caroline was his favourite by far. Later he became a singer in a band, then started doing discos when he was 18. He joined Caroline in 1977, touring the country with the Caroline Roadshow for 10 years, having great fun. Barry helped with tender trips and worked on the Ross Revenge in '84 and '85. ...

Kevin Blumenfeld is a respected composer, orchestrator and synthesist who has worked on films for with Hans Zimmer and Harry Gregson-Williams such as Pearl Harbor, Black Hawk Down, The Ring, Tears of the Sun, Matchstick Men, and Shrek 2, and scored many of his own TV and films including The Walking Dead, and In The Vault. In this episode Kevin takes us on a musical journey using the Moog Mother 32 and one of the stand out tracks from In The Vault, Suspects. He also walks us through his creative process when scoring and his reasons for turning to the Mother 32 for recent sound track work. Sit back, relax and enjoy.
